PlasmaBlock® Air Cooled

70g @ 5%, 65g @ 10%

Overview

A new design PlasmaBlock® featuring a one-piece block/heat sink that dissipates heat more efficiently and allows greater ozone generation related to it's overall size. The Gen2 block in this product will produce 65g per hour of 10% wt ozone.  Service simplicity due to automatic fault diagnostics.

Product Details

  • Wi-Fi and digital communications available as an option. Simple and less expensive.
  • Service simplicity due to automatic fault diagnostics.
  • Easily interface to PLC or computer.
  • Micro Processor based, installation simplicity and automatic tuning for constant ozone output.
  • Automatic bus voltage compensation stabilizes output as power line conditions change.
  • Efficient, compact, silent (25khz), safe, rugged, reliable, advanced – all the normal traits of a PTI product.  Same precise linear control, with turn down to 1%, as all Plasma Block products.
  • Maximum up-time , durable, commercial / industrial solution the ozone industry requires.
  • Control connections of the essential I/O functions are the same as all other Plasma Block products.
  • PDM, Voltage and Frequency potentiometers have their own jumper selection for on board control if desired.
  • Line voltage 240v (standard and UL approved), 120v available (UL approved).
  • Military grade conformal coating eliminates problems associated with condensation and mold as well as greatly retarding damaged caused by accidental ozone exposure.
  • Like all other Plasma Block products, the feed gas supply must be either PSA concentrator or bottle feed of at least -60°F dew point, filtered, positive-pressure oxygen.
  • There is an inherent pressure drop associated with each Plasma Block.  This can vary depending on the desired flow.  Verification of the outlet pressure, at the desired flow, of the Plasma Block is crucial in order to prevent a negative pressure drop in the Plasma Block.  This will damage the Plasma Block internals and is not a warrantied repair.

 

Configuration options

PTI will set up and tune units to the customers desired specifications.

Oxygen pressure - (5 - 100 psi) (UL 5x rated)
Oxygen flow liters/minute - stats available soon
Heat load btu/hr = stats available soon
Inlet fittings (none, 1/4",3/8, other)
Outlet fittings (none, 1/4", 3/8, other)

Weight Lbs (Kg) :

34.5 Lbs. (15.68) Kg.

 

DAT210 is the standard control circuit board for this unit.
